select the correct descriptor of the following problems: from a pack of 52 cards, two cards drawn together at random. What is th
Marianna [84]

Answer:

\frac{1}{221}

Step-by-step explanation:

We have to note that there are 4 kings in a deck of 52 cards.

This makes the probability of choosing a king the first time \frac{4}{52} = \frac{1}{13}.

We now know that we can choose another king from the deck, but it's important to note that it's not a \frac{1}{13} chance. We now only have 51 cards in the deck, and 3 kings left. This means the probability of choosing a king now is \frac{3}{51} = \frac{1}{17}.

To find the probability of doing both these, we need to multiply the fractions.

\frac{1}{13}\cdot\frac{1}{17}=\frac{1}{221}
